We've been using the Assignment Enhancements for some time and love it.
We also use TurnItIn LTI integration for most of our summative submissions for similarity report, but continue to use SpeedGrader for Feedback and Marking of submitted work.
The Problem
For the first time this year, I noticed that when an assignment has TurnItIn (External Tool) turned on, the TII submission inbox effectively replaces the window in which the student would see any of the in-line feedback for the task. (See attached image Feedback1.jpg)
Current Solution
We either have to turn the assignment enhancements feature off to ever back to the old GUI (attached Feedback2.jpg) or teachers need to switch TurnItIn off when they release their grades to students so that the default Canvas feedback interface appears.
Question
Is there a way that the feedback in the enhanced view can be visible even if TurnItIn is enabled for an assignment?
It seems we are also having this isssue with Google Drive Cloud LTI assignments as well. Clicking on the assignment name in the student grade summary takes you back to the assignment, not to viewing the annotations/feedback like it does without Assignment Enhancements. I just wanted you to know you are not the only one having this issue with certain LTIs.
